diff options
author | Johannes Schickel | 2009-09-13 21:48:02 +0000 |
---|---|---|
committer | Johannes Schickel | 2009-09-13 21:48:02 +0000 |
commit | b6d33f1667ecd2e8bb1b16b85f5db4bae2046054 (patch) | |
tree | 2dec2e5c39a4989398e0d296350ed64406c75919 /engines/kyra/sound_towns.cpp | |
parent | b73f9ab41ecada2a9971834e1ef1bb4c106cbec3 (diff) | |
download | scummvm-rg350-b6d33f1667ecd2e8bb1b16b85f5db4bae2046054.tar.gz scummvm-rg350-b6d33f1667ecd2e8bb1b16b85f5db4bae2046054.tar.bz2 scummvm-rg350-b6d33f1667ecd2e8bb1b16b85f5db4bae2046054.zip |
- Cleanup
- Fix mismatching new[]/delete
svn-id: r44075
Diffstat (limited to 'engines/kyra/sound_towns.cpp')
-rw-r--r-- | engines/kyra/sound_towns.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/engines/kyra/sound_towns.cpp b/engines/kyra/sound_towns.cpp index 0c67b1e83a..ffa9f720a7 100644 --- a/engines/kyra/sound_towns.cpp +++ b/engines/kyra/sound_towns.cpp @@ -4075,14 +4075,14 @@ bool SoundPC98::init() { void SoundPC98::loadSoundFile(Common::String file) { if (_sfxTrackData) - delete _sfxTrackData; + delete[] _sfxTrackData; _sfxTrackData = _vm->resource()->fileData(file.c_str(), 0); } void SoundPC98::loadSoundFile(const uint8 *data, int len) { if (_sfxTrackData) - delete _sfxTrackData; + delete[] _sfxTrackData; _sfxTrackData = new uint8[len]; memcpy(_sfxTrackData, data, len); |